A motorist travels 228 kilometers in 6 hours. At that rate, how long will it take him to travel and additional 247 kilometers?
Answer:
The motorist's rate is:
rate = distance / time
where distance is measured in kilometers and time is measured in hours.
We are given that the motorist travels 228 kilometers in 6 hours, so we can use this information to find the rate:
rate = distance / time = 228 km / 6 hours = 38 km/hour
To find how long it will take the motorist to travel an additional 247 kilometers at this rate, we can use the same formula and solve for time:
time = distance / rate = 247 km / 38 km/hour ≈ 6.5 hours
Therefore, it will take the motorist approximately 6.5 hours to travel an additional 247 kilometers at the same rate of 38 km/hour.

11. Albert has 12 more 10 cent coins than 20-cent
coins. The total value of all his coins is $5.40. Find
the total number of coins he has.
Step-by-step explanation:
Let x be the number of 10 cent coins
Let y be the number of 20 cent coins
given
\(x = y + 12 \\ x - y = 12\)
as equation 1
and
\(0.1x + 0.2y = 5.4\)
as equation 2.
Now we will use elimination method to solve simultaneous equations.
Now we multiply equation 1 by 0.2 to eliminate y and solve for x first.
\(0.2 \times x - 0.2 \times y = 12 \times 0.2 \\ 0.2x - 0.2y = 2.4\)
Let this new equation be equation 3.
Now use equation 2 + equation 3.
\(0.1x + 0.2x + (0.2y + ( - 0.2y)) = 5.4 + 2.4 \\ 0.3x = 7.8 \\ x = 7.8 \div 0.3 \\ = 26\)
Substitute x into equation 1,
\(x = y + 12 \\ y + 12 = x \\ y = x - 12 \\ = 26 - 12 \\ = 14\)
Therefore total number of coins = x + y = 26 + 14 = 40

Sera had the number 548.She adds one to the tens and two to the units. What number would Sera end up with??
The number she'd have is:
560Explanation:
First, let's see which number is in the tens place and which number is in the ones place (the units place).
In the number 548, the place value of 5 is hundreds, the place value of 4 is tens, and the place value of 8 is ones (or units).
So if Sera adds two to the units, she'll have 10. But, since we can't write the number as 5410 (that would be a totally different number), we just write 0 in the units place, and shift 1 to the tens place, which gives us :
550
That's not all, since we also add 1 to the tens:
560
Hence, Sera ends up with 560.
